A new addition to Evans RIDE IT series for 2018 sees them partnering with Crawley Wheelers to host alongside the Ardingly round of the Cyclocross National Trophy. You get a chance to test your skills with a starting lap on the National Trophy Cyclocross course then watch the elite riders race in the afternoon after the ride.
The sportive cross course includes a mix of lanes, cycle tracks and bridleways so is suitable for MTB, cyclocross, adventure road bikes with tyres that can handle some off road riding. The route took us away from Ardingly past Weir Wood Reservoir before we joined the gravel tracks of the Forest Way into East Grinstead. From here we pick up some more gravel cycle tracks taking us along the Worth Way to the outskirts of Crawley before picking up a series of bridleways through Tilgate Forest and Oldhouse Warren. We continue on through Balcombe then itβs a picturesque skirt around the edge of Ardingly Reservoir before returning to the finish to collect a finishers medal.
Like all Evans events the course is fully waymarked, you can ride with others or at your own pace and there will be a feed stop around half distance along with a sweeper vehicle should you need support on your ride.

The starting loop on the National Trophy Cyclocross course is optional for those that want to sample what the elite racers will compete on later in the day.
It had rained the night before and there was a slight change to the course and some of it was pretty slippy ! It was a really good mixture off off road, single track and road riding. Plenty to eat and drink at the food stop and lots of people turned up. A well marked course with something for everyone.

Be prepared to get wet and muddy. Oversocks and full finger gloves were welcome. A well stocked saddle bag with essentials is always good practice and a willingness to pedal hard and get nowhere in some of the muddy parts!!
